、等,它们能够更好地描述页面结构,提高可读性。使用语义化标签能够让代码更加清晰,方便搜索引擎抓取和理解页面内容。1.2 盒子模型盒子模型是页面布局中重要的概念,每个HTML元素都被看作是一个盒子。它包括内容区域、内边距、边框和外边距。合理运用盒子模型能够控制元素的大小、位置以及与其他元素间的关系。1.3 Flexbox布局Flexbox是一种弹性盒子布局模型,能够实现简单而灵活的页面布局。项目只需设置父元素为display:flex,然后通过设置子元素的属性,即可控制子元素的排列顺序、间距等,使布局更加适应不同设备和屏幕尺寸。二、HTML布局技巧2.1 响应式设计随着移动端设备的普及,响应式设计已成为网页设计中的一项重要技巧。通过使用CSS媒体查询和弹性布局,使网页能够自适应不同屏幕尺寸,让用户在各种设备上都能有良好的浏览体验。2.2 位置定位使用CSS的position属性可以控制元素的位置。有static、relative、absolute和fixed四种定位方式,通过合理设置,我们能够精确地控制元素在页面上的位置,实现复杂的布局效果。2.3 网格布局CSS Grid Layout是一种强大的网格布局系统,通过将页面划分为行和列的网格,能够实现复杂的多列布局。通过设置网格项的大小、位置和间距,让页面看起来更加整齐美观。2.4 弹性图片为了适应不同屏幕尺寸,图片的大小也需要灵活调整。我们可以利用CSS的max-width属性和width:auto属性,使图片在不同设备上自动调整大小,以保证内容的完整显示。三、JS拼接换行HTML错误虽然JS能够在HTML中动态生成内容,但如果不注意细节,就容易出现拼接换行HTML的错误。比如,我们经常会使用字符串的拼接来生成HTML代码,但忽略了换行符,导致生成的HTML代码格式混乱,可读性差。为避免这种错误,我们应使用合适的工具或技术来帮助我们生成格式良好的HTML代码。比如,我们可以使用模板字符串(Template String)来拼接HTML代码,其中支持换行符的使用,让代码更具可读性。另外,可以使用前端框架中的模板引擎,如Vue.js的模板语法,能够更方便地生成HTML代码,并且保持代码的结构整洁。总结:HTML布局元素和布局技巧是实现网页布局的重要基础。通过合理运用语义化标签、盒子模型和Flexbox布局,我们能够更好地控制网页的结构和样式。同时,响应式设计、位置定位、网格布局和弹性图片等布局技巧也能够让网页在不同设备上呈现出最佳效果。在使用JS拼接换行HTML时,我们需要注意细节,采用合适的工具来生成格式良好的HTML代码。让我们一同追寻时尚潮流,以炫彩的网页布局亮相吧! 如果你喜欢我们三七知识分享网站的文章, 欢迎您分享或收藏知识分享网站文章 欢迎您到我们的网站逛逛喔!https://www.ynyuzhu.com/
发表评论 取消回复